Highlights
Are people in Rock Hill older or younger than people in Scranton?
- The Median Age in Rock Hill is 15.2 years older than in Scranton.

Are housing costs cheaper in Rock Hill or Scranton?
- Rock Hill housing costs are 148.3% more expensive than Scranton hous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Rock Hill or Scranton?
- The average commute for residents of Rock Hill is 11.4 minutes longer than it is for residents of Scranton.

Things to do in Scranton?
Scranton, Pennsylvania is a vibrant city located in the northeastern corner of the United States. Home to attractions such as Lackawanna River Heritage Trail and Steamtown National Historic Site, visitors can explore outdoor activities and historical sites when visiting Scranton. There are also plenty of museums, galleries, and performance venues such as Everhart Museum and The Governor’s Gallery of Fine Arts. For entertainment, visitors can explore boutique shops and restaurants along with movie theaters and live music clubs.
